Pierre Menard Home Historic Site is a park in Illinois, at a recorded 164 m. Little Vine Hill stands 298 m to the west-southwest, 24 miles off. The nearest named place is French Colonial Historic District, a park 0.3 miles away. Great River Road passes 1.5 miles off. 84 named places lie within 25 miles, 19 of them named summits.

Months averaging 50–80 °F: Apr–Oct.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 32 | 37 | 46 | 56 | 66 | 75 | 79 | 77 | 70 | 58 | 46 | 36 |
| Precip in | 2.7 | 2.4 | 3.4 | 4.7 | 5.2 | 4.1 | 4.1 | 3.3 | 2.9 | 3.1 | 4.0 | 2.8 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Kaskaskia RVR Navigation Lock, 3 mi away.
